[pdf] The national average for a solar well pump is around $2,000, but you can pay as low as $900 or as high as $4,500. Bigger well depths, higher flow rates, and more solar panels will increase your cost. The included buying. . When installing photovoltaic panels on one- and two-family homes, it's important to understand the requirements for access pathways and the requirements for setback from the ridge, which only apply to roofs with a slope greater than a 2-in-12 pitch.
